我的 web.config 中有以下设置:
<appSettings>
<add key="ClientValidationEnabled" value="true"/>
<add key="UnobtrusiveJavaScriptEnabled" value="true"/>
</appSettings>
我没有使用任何客户端验证。
我应该将它们设置为false
还是只删除这两个条目就可以了?
最佳答案
如果您不想要它,请将其设置为 false。这样您甚至不必稍后猜测默认值是什么,项目中的其他人可以立即看出将其关闭是您的意图。
同时从捆绑配置中删除客户端验证,以防止用户进行不必要的下载。
关于asp.net - 我可以通过从 web.config 中删除条目来关闭所有 MVC 客户端验证吗,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/19163767/